Minimum Age to Obtain a Driver’s License in California

In California, the minimum age to obtain a driver’s license is 16 years old. Applicants must complete a driver’s education course, pass a written exam, and a driving test.

However, teenagers under the age of 18 must hold a provisional license for 12 months before obtaining a full license. During this time, they are not allowed to drive between the hours of 11 PM and 5 AM, and they must be accompanied by an adult over the age of 25.

It is important to note that the minimum age to rent a car in California also varies depending on the rental company. While some companies may allow renters as young as 18, others require renters to be at least 21 years old. Additionally, renters under the age of 25 may be subject to additional fees and restrictions.

Requirements For Teenagers to Get a Driver’s License

To obtain a driver’s license in California, teenagers must fulfill certain requirements. Below are the specifics that must be met before one can get behind the wheel:

  • Teenagers must be at least 16 years old to apply for their driver’s license in California.
  • They will need to provide appropriate identification along with proof of residency in California.
  • Passing a written exam, vision test and receiving a learner’s permit are among some additional prerequisites required by the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V).

It is important to note that holding a learner’s permit for at least six months and completing 50 hours of supervised driving practice is necessary before taking the final driving test. Moreover, it is crucial to understand that failing to abide by traffic laws or receive any traffic violation tickets during this period may result in additional delays in obtaining a driver’s license. Restrictions For Drivers Under 18 Years Old

Driving rules and regulations for individuals aged under 18 come with some restrictions. Teenagers in California can obtain a driver’s license at the age of 16, but certain conditions must be met before being allowed to freely explore the streets behind the steering wheel. These restrictions have been put in place to ensure the safety of young drivers.

To begin with, before obtaining a driver’s license, teens must first complete a state-approved driver education program and gain their learner’s permit. This is valid for one year and states that teens cannot drive alone under any circumstances. They must always be accompanied by an approved licensed driver aged above 25 years.

In addition, teens are also restricted from driving between specific hours—11 PM to 5 AM—for the first year after getting their license unless there is an emergency or a licensed adult aged above 25 sits alongside them.

Moreover, in California, drivers aged below 18 cannot use electronic communication devices while driving unless it is an emergency. Violating these rules may result in penalties such as fines or restrictions on driving privileges.

Age Restrictions For Renting a Car in California

Renting a car in California has varying age restrictions depending on the rental agency and vehicle type. Some agencies allow drivers as young as 18 to rent, while others require drivers to be at least 25 years old. The minimum age to rent a car may also depend on the type of vehicle rented, with some upscale or exotic cars requiring drivers to be at least 30 years old.

It’s important to note that if you meet the minimum age requirements, you may still face higher fees or restrictions due to your age. Some companies charge extra fees for younger drivers or place limits on what types of vehicles they can rent.

To ensure you meet all requirements before booking a rental car, make sure to check with the specific rental company and ask about their age policies and pricing structures. Additionally, it may be wise to consider purchasing extra insurance coverage since younger drivers are statistically more likely to get into accidents.

Car Rental Companies’ Policies on Minimum Age Requirements

Car rental services have specific age requirements for customers who wish to rent a vehicle. To address this rule, we can take a comprehensive look at the age policies of car rental companies.

The following table shows car rental company names and their minimum age requirements:

Rental Company

Minimum Age Required

Enterprise

21 years old

Hertz

20 years old

Avis

21 years old

Budget

21 years old but may differ per location

Thrifty

20 years old

It is important to note that additional fees may apply for renters under the age of 25. Also, some locations may have an upper age limit for rentals.

Using Public Transportation

Public transportation is an effective alternative to renting a car for underage drivers. It provides safe, affordable and eco-friendly transportation options.

  • Various forms of public transportation like buses, trains, and subways are available in almost every city.
  • Many public transportation services offer discounted rates for students and young adults.
  • Using public transportation also helps reduce traffic congestion and air pollution.

When using public transportation, it’s essential to plan ahead by checking schedules and routes. Additionally, it is advisable to travel during off-peak hours as it reduces the crowd on public transport.
